Field Guide - difference between Inedible and Poisonous?
    #14226233 - 04/02/11 01:51 PM (12 years, 9 months ago)

What is the real difference? Why would a mushroom be considered inedible if it werent poisonous? Just because it tastes bad?

Inedible includes anything that might make it impossible (in a realistic sense) to eat some mushrooms. Some of them would be like eating a piece of wood, some are simply so vile tasting that no sane person could eat one. There are mushrooms out there that are so nasty that even Captain MacIlvaine couldn't bring himself to eat one - and he actually liked stinkhorns and a few other things that most people would consider inedible.

Poisonous is used to describe mushrooms that contain "toxins" - chemical substances that have effects that aren't nutritious or beneficial. Psilocybin (and its chemical relatives) fall into this category because most people actually would find the effects (if taken unintentionally) alarming. There are lots of visits to emergency rooms around the country every year by people that have eaten psilocybin or something similar, including people that have taken them intentionally. Poisonous doesn't necessarily mean that there is any actual harm. Most poisonous mushrooms just make the victim feel sick. It's also worth noting that many mushrooms listed as poisonous are only toxic to some percentage of the population, not everybody. Some are even poisonous to only a minority. Generally, the listing as poisonous indicates that some people that eat them end up in the emergency room.
